
Russia's Ballistic Missile Attack Kills 17 Near Kyiv, Ukraine Fails to Intercept
At least 17 people were killed in a Russian ballistic missile attack on Kyiv and its surrounding areas, with Ukraine reporting that it failed to intercept any of the incoming missiles. This incident highlights Ukraine's critical shortage of air defense capabilities against such sophisticated attacks.

At least 17 people were killed and more than 40 injured in another round of deadly Russian strikes on the Ukrainian capital, Kyiv. Volodymyr Zelenskyy has pleaded for more air defence weapons, saying ballistic missile interceptors ‘could have saved the lives of those killed today’. For months, Ukraine has been warning about shortages after Donald Trump backtracked on his promise to let Ukraine manufacture missiles locally.
